Abstract

Electronic watt hour meters(WHM) for high pressure running in domestic were installed to the digital type meter and ones for low pressure are expected to complete within several years. Domestic power metering technology is being beyond a simple framework with an electronic type and is rapidly evolving to intelligent smart metering systems in conjunction with promotion of a national smart grid project. Major policy outlook of the world's major power company regarding Intelligent metering is the application of the fare structure diversification and is the improvement of level of service to customers. In addition, electric power companies should focus on the cost reduction and the improvement of management efficiency through an efficient operation of distribution facility. In this paper, we are about to make an observation of the additional services technology development trend of the overseas smart meter and to have a view of value-added services(VAS) system of smart meter suitable for the domestic environment based on the technology development of VAS utilizing electronic watt hour meter performed by recent research projects.
